Albert Ramos-Vinolas def. Tsung-Hua Yang
3-6 6-3 7-5
Albert Ramos-Vinolas defeated Tsung-Hua Yang 3-6 6-3 7-5 in the 2011 China Open first qualifying round on hard courts on October 3, 2011.
